Official Description
A security flaw has been discovered in pixelsock directus-mcp 1.0.0. This issue affects the function validateUrl of the file index.ts of the component MCP Interface. Performing a manipulation of the argument fileUrl results in server-side request forgery. The attack may be initiated remotely. The exploit has been released to the public and may be used for attacks. The pull request to fix this issue awaits acceptance.
